November 22, 2017 5:05 AM ESTBarclays lowered its price target on HP Enterprise (NYSE: HPE) to $13.00 (from $14.00) while maintaining a Underweight rating.
Analyst Mark Moskowitz expects shares to remain under-pressure in the NT and believes the CEO transition timing could add to uncertainty for the company's narrative.

November 21, 2017 4:09 PM ESTHewlett Packard Enterprise (NYSE: HPE) today announced that, effective February 1, 2018, Antonio Neri, current President of HPE, will become President and Chief Executive Officer, and will join the HPE Board of Directors. Meg Whitman, current Chief Executive Officer, will remain on the HPE Board of Directors.
